The retailer is currently testing a new delivery service that allows its drivers to access homes with keyless Yale smart lock technology. The service is currently being tested in Coulsdon (south London). The service will allow delivery drivers to put away frozen and refrigerated goods, but other groceries can be left on kitchen counters. The entire transaction will be filmed on the camera that is attached to the driver's chest.

In addition to the brand new online shopping sites london center the parent company John Lewis Partnership has quadrupled the number of shopping slots in London to meet the high demand during the outbreak. This means that a lot of online customers, who are following government advice and are in isolation are able to choose from four times as many slots. The retailer also stated that it will continue to prioritize vulnerable shoppers after the lockdown has ended.

The upscale supermarket chain is attempting to claw back its share of the UK grocery market, which has fallen from 5.1pc to 4.6pc since the beginning of 2021. The company's share has decreased further due to several prominent initiatives from rivals such as Tesco, Sainsbury's, and Morrisons which have gained ground on discounters Lidl and Aldi.

Discount chains like Lidl and Aldi have increased their market share, which is putting pressure on the upscale British grocery store. Nevertheless, Waitrose still ranks first in a recent survey conducted by Market Force Information on customer perceptions of seven supermarket chains. The survey involved 4300 customers who evaluated supermarkets based on their selection, layout and cleanliness.

Waitrose has taken a number of measures to safeguard customers and staff during the coronavirus outbreak. Customers are asked to send only one person shopping and to wear a scarf or mask.
